The Advanced Manufacturing Engineering Specialist will lead and oversee multiple complex projects focused on optimizing material flow, material storage, and advanced manufacturing processes across multi-site operations. The specialist will interact directly with Design Engineering, Program Managers, Logistics, Purchasing, and Operations Teams to coordinate and execute manufacturing milestones and deliverables while ensuring the right materials are delivered to the right place, at the right time, with minimal waste. This position requiresdeep technical expertisein material management, lean methodologies, and digital manufacturing technologies. Responsibilities Material Flow & Storage Optimization Collaborate with cross-functional teams including Production, Logistics, Engineering, and Purchasing to align material flow systems with business goals andproduction scheduling requirements. Identify bottlenecks and inefficiencies in current material flow processes and proposedata-driven, quantified solutionswith measurable impact on throughput and cost reduction. Partner closely with the warehousing team to evaluatespace utilization using slotting optimization techniques, streamline storage strategies, and implement best practices that support lean manufacturing principles. Analyze, design, and implementoptimized material flow strategiesusingsimulation modeling and digital twin technologiesto ensure end-to-end synchronization across suppliers, internal operations, and warehouse environments. Continuously monitor and analyzeKPIsrelated to materials movement such as throughput, cycle time, delivery performance, and inventory accuracy, usingreal-time data dashboards and analytics platforms. Design and implementsupermarket pull systems and kanban replenishment strategiesto synchronize material flow with production demand. Develop standardized workflows andStandard Operating Procedures (SOPs)to ensure materials move efficiently from receiving to point-of-use. Applywarehouse management system (WMS) capabilitiesto improve inventory visibility, traceability, and accuracy across the facility. Ensure compliance with safety, ergonomic, and environmental standards in all flow system designs, incorporatingergonomic risk assessments and material handling equipment specifications. Implementation ofautomated material handling systems (AMHS), includingAutomated Guided Vehicles (AGVs), conveyor systems, and robotic pick-and-place solutions, as well as digital transformation and Industry 4.0 initiatives focused on connected and intelligent material handling. Leadcapacity planning and load balancing analysesto ensure material flow. Manufacturing Engineering & Technical Leadership Work closely with Line of Business Leaders to ensure manufacturing plans are aligned to Product Roadmaps andlong-term strategic growth objectives. Lead, develop, and implementcomprehensive manufacturing plansfor assigned new products according to the NPDI program, applyingDesign for Manufacturability (DFM) and Design for Assembly (DFA)principles. Lead and provide direct support for plant-to-plant product transfers and new product development programs, ensuringtechnical feasibility assessmentsandmanufacturing readiness reviewsare completed at each program gate. Responsible for the execution of Manufacturing Readiness Checklists and deliverables of the NPDI Process, includingprocess capability studiesandfailure mode and effects analysis (FMEA). Leader for Manufacturing Prototype builds along with the local operations team to achieve2-week lead time, applyingrapid prototyping methodologiesand iterative build strategies. Assist with business-critical capital projects includingfacility planning, layout optimization using simulation tools, and detailed cost justification with ROI analysis. Applytime and motion studies, ergonomic assessments, and workstation design principlesto optimize operator efficiency and safety. Develop and maintaintechnical engineering standards, work instructions, and process control plansto ensure consistency across manufacturing sites. Leadroot cause analysis (RCA)andcorrective action processesfor manufacturing-related issues using structured problem-solving methodologies such as8D, A3, and Fishbone analysis. Advanced Engineering & Digital Manufacturing Applysimulation and modeling tools(e.g., Arena, Simio, FlexSim, or equivalent) to validate material flow designs before physical implementation. Support the integration ofERP/MRP systems (Oracle, SAP)with shop floor execution systems to enablereal-time material visibility and automated replenishment triggers. Developvalue stream maps (VSM)for current and future states, identifying waste elimination opportunities and quantifying improvement potential across the entire material flow value chain. Lead the evaluation and implementation ofIndustry 4.0 and Smart Manufacturing technologies, including IoT-enabled material tracking, RFID systems, and real-time location systems (RTLS). Continuous Improvement Support Vertiv manufacturing operations usingstandard processes, equipment, and manufacturing methods, driving consistency and repeatability across sites. Lead and participate incontinuous improvement initiativessuch as Kaizen events, Lean Manufacturing projects, andSix Sigma DMAIC projectstargeting material flow and storage optimization. Develop and trackimprovement roadmapswith clearly defined milestones, resource requirements, and expected financial benefits. Qualifications Minimum Bachelor's degree inIndustrial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Supply Chain Management, Business Operations Management, or related field. 4–5 yearsof experience in advanced manufacturing, materials flow engineering, supply chain logistics, or lean manufacturing. Preferred Master's degree(MSME/IE/MBA)with5+ yearsof Advanced Manufacturing experience. Lean Manufacturing and Six Sigma formal training or certifications(Green Belt or Black Belt preferred). Experience withsimulation and modeling softwarefor material flow and facility layout design. Familiarity withIndustry 4.0 technologies, including IoT, RFID, AGVs, and digital twin platforms. Requirements Knowledge of formalizedAdvanced and Lean Manufacturing applications, includingvalue stream mapping, takt time analysis, inventory decoupling strategies, kanban systems, and pull-based replenishment. Experience inNew Product Development, Product Transfers, and Material Flow optimizationacross multi-site environments. Strong knowledge ofmanufacturing process engineering principles, including DFM/DFA, FMEA, process capability analysis, and control plans. Experience withERP/MRP systems (Oracle, SAP)for integrated planning and material control, including shop floor integration. Solid knowledge indata analysis toolssuch as Excel, Power BI, Minitab, or equivalent analytical platforms. Goodvertical communication, interpersonal, and motivation skills, with the ability to present technical findings to senior leadership. Ability to achieve results throughteam building and teamwork. Analytical mindsetwith strong problem-solving skills and structured thinking. Physical & Environmental Demands The role is primarily based in amanufacturing facility, requiring regular site visits and interaction with production teams. Required to wearpersonal protective equipment (PPE)and adhere to safety protocols. The role involves extended periods ofsitting in front of a computer and periods in production floor. Walkingmay be required during meetings, presentations, or site visits. Travel Required 10% travel to different plant locations and suppliers.
